| - We tried it yesterday for a late lunch and then AGAIN today for a 7PM dinner, yeah it really is that good.
We really like this place compared to other Japanese noodle places in Henderson, the noodle portion is a decent size and I would think you would order the extra side of noodle portion if you are really in need of a noodle belly bomb. The broth is perfectly seasoned and you have several choices to choose from as well as extra toppings. We suggest you try the crispy rice appetizer, it's crunchy rice with spicy tuna on top, very unusual and very delicious I didn't really like the soft white Chasu buns with the pork in them, but my wife did and apparently it's a favorite of many others. I tried the Kim Chee fried rice and it was well done and not too oily or overly spicy. Also I went outside the box and tried their cold noodle dish and it was to me the best thing I ever ate in 2014 and will probably order that dish more than the hot soup dishes that usually gets me overheated. (not in spice, but in warmth) but I guess that is the draw to have some hot noodles in the winter time. The drinks are served in cans with a side of ice, but hopefully they will have a fountain to serve from later since a per can charge for soft drinks can add up on the refills. Also some flat screen TV's on the walls would be very welcomed during sports time, but then again maybe not since the place is small and people are usually always waiting for a table, so probably better for people to eat and leave right away to make room for others. The wooden benches are kind of uncomfortable, but as I said, they want you to eat and make room for other diners, so eat eat eat and go go go!
Prices are very reasonable, the food is tasty and not overly salty, lots of flavors involved here, really good eats! The odds are we will be back within the week, very well done!
